Abstract: An organic light-emitting device having improved efficiency and lifespan includes: a first electrode, a second electrode, and an organic layer between the first electrode and the second electrode, wherein the organic layer includes an emission layer, the emission layer includes a first compound, a second compound, a third compound, and a fourth compound, the first compound, the second compound, the third compound, and the fourth compound are different from each other, the third compound includes a metal element having an atomic number of 40 or more, the fourth compound includes boron (B), the third compound and the fourth compound each satisfy Conditions 1-1 and 1-2 below, and the fourth compound satisfies Condition 2 or 3: T1(C3)onset≥S1(C4)onset Condition 1-1 T1(C3)max≥S1(C4)max Condition 1-2 KRISC(C4)≥103S−1 Condition 2 f(C4)≥0.1. Condition 3

Abstract: A liquid crystal display device includes an upper substrate, a lower substrate including a data line and a gate line insulated from the data line, a liquid crystal layer between the lower substrate and the upper substrate, a current sensing unit which detects a data current based on a data signal applied to the data line so as to detect a change in a liquid crystal capacitance of the liquid crystal layer, a rectifying amplifier which rectifies or amplifies the detected data current so as to generate and output a rectified signal, a pulse generator which generates a sensing pulse by comparing the rectified signal with a reference voltage, and a duty width detector which detects a duty width of the sensing pulse generated by the pulse generator where the reference voltage is set based on a voltage difference between data signals successively applied to the data line.
